DEVOUT
DEVOUT provides a glimpse into the life of a 22-year-old Georgian Orthodox monk, Father Anubi, as he contemplates his understanding of faith. This inspirational story follows him as he travels the forest paths, allegory for his spiritual journey, between the many monasteries in his pristine, picturesque valley. The film bears cinematic witness to his internalized struggle as it presents a stunning visual portrait of the monks, their contemporary, ritualistic lives, and the work inside the monasteries. The camera unlocks the hidden mystery of Georgian monastic life as it travels to 17 Dzama Valley monasteries including one-perched 1400 meters on a cliff-side and was given access to a previously unrecorded sacred site that contains the remains from long ago invasions, hundreds of bones and the skulls of murdered monks, priests, bishops, and children dating from the 6th century.

Director and fine artist James Higginson(Emmy Award, 1989) premiered his first feature length experimental art film, WILLFUL BLINDNESS, a visual experience, in 2012. WILLFUL BLINDNESS received 2 awards on the international independent film festival circuit, an award of merit from LIFF, premiered in Germany as part of the Neue Deutsche Film Program in Berlin, 2013 and held the Italian Premeire at Palazzo Zenobio during the 55th Venice Biennale, 2013.
Higginson followed this success with the documentary film, DEVOUT, 2016. This feature bore cinematic witness to the internalized struggle of a young Georgian Orthodox monk as it presented a stunning visual portrait of the work and lives inside the remote monasteries. DEVOUT received awards of excellence from the IMPACT DOC Awards! and IndieFEST Film Awards.
Higginson combines his 30+ years working as a fine artist and Hollywood professional to drive his creative auteur cinematic works. He confronts the viewer with arresting images that reveal the unspoken of today's world— the sacred, the profane, the spiritual and the material. The question Higginson consistently addresses is how to tell the stories of which we all are made and addresses issues that expose our human frailty.
